Today in 1972, Grand Funk Railroad were on stage at Madison Square Garden when their former manager, Terry Knight, arrived with a court order saying he could seize one million dollars worth of money or assets from the band. He impounded their instruments and equipment as soon as they were done.  

On this day in 1968, John Lennon and Yoko Ono, dressed as Mr. and Mrs. Claus, visited the Apple Records offices during their Christmas Party, handing out presents to children of the staff.
